个人简介

二级教授,博士生导师,中国自动化学会会士(CAA Fellow)。1979年9月至1983年7月就读于湖南大学应用数学系,获理学学士学位;1983年8月至1995年8月,任教于东北重型机械学院;1995年9月至1997年6月,就读于华南理工大学控制理论与应用专业博士研究生,获工学博士学位,被评为广东十佳博士(第一名)。1997年7月起,任教于华南理工大学。1999年晋升为教授,2000年增列为博士研究生导师。先后于香港中文大学、美国伊利诺伊州立大学(UIUC)工作、学习。

历任华南理工大学工业技术总院院长、国家大学科技园主任、IEEE SMC Guangzhou Chapter主席、中国系统工程学会理事、中国系统仿真学会控制系统仿真专业委员会委员;现任华南理工大学学术委员会委员、系统工程研究所所长;IEEE CSS Guangzhou Chapter主席、中国自动化学会控制理论专业委员会(TCCT)委员、广东省物联网技术标准委员会主任、广东省第六届学位委员会学科评议组成员、广州工程管理学会会长;国际刊物IEEE Access 副编(Associate Editor)、《华南理工大学学报》(自然科学版)副主编、《控制理论与应用》、SCI收录刊物《系统工程与电子技术》、《系统工程学报》、《系统与控制纵横》等刊编委、《系统科学与数学》客座主编、《南京信息工程大学学报》客座主编、《中国科学》客座编辑、CCC-中国科学张贴论文奖评奖委员会委员、2020、2022 IEEE SMC Conference 候任技术主席;TCCT随机系统控制学组主任;中国仿真学会不确定性系统分析与仿真专业委员会副主任。

研究领域

主要研究复杂系统控制理论:

1、所涉及模型包括:滞后系统、随机系统、跳变系统、非线性系统、大系统等;

2、所研究的问题包括:系统的建模、仿真、稳定性、镇定与控制。
